Step 4 — Image slimming. Before approving, confirm the Dockerfile for the Quillbase API uses the two-stage build: compile in the fat builder image, copy only the binary and certs into the scratch layer. Reject PRs that keep build tools, package caches, or debug shells in the final image. Target size is under 40 MB. Once the slimmed image passes the smoke suite, it must be signed before registry push; the pipeline signs with the release key below.

rollout seal: bky4_x7Gc

Loading dock — Pellbridge Works. Delivery hours are 07:30–11:00 and 13:30–16:00, Monday to Friday. No weekend deliveries without prior booking through the facilities desk. Contractors must reverse in, engines off while unloading, and keep the dock apron clear at all times. Maximum dwell time is 30 minutes. Oversized loads need 48 hours' notice. Hi-vis required beyond the yellow line. The roller shutter is operated from the internal panel; use the keypad by the side door with the code below.

staff pass of kawip-hawef = bdg-QLP-2

Welcome to the Brindlewood front desk! One of your jobs is minding the key cabinet for our pool cars. It lives behind reception, next to the umbrella stand. Staff sign out keys in the green logbook — no signature, no keys, no exceptions. The cabinet locks automatically, so you'll need the pass code below to open it.

door code, yagap-bahof: bdg-O-05

Fan-out backpressure for the Quillet notifier: when the queue depth crosses the soft limit, the dispatcher sheds low-priority pushes and batches the rest at 500ms intervals. Reviewer should confirm the shed counter is exported and that retries respect the jitter window. Once merged, the release artifact gets re-signed by the pipeline, which expects the deploy key shown below.

deploy key for bawep-yawif: bky6_GQhaSt

**Q: Why do converted totals sometimes differ by a cent?** Short answer: Ledgerline rounds per line item, not per invoice, so sums can drift slightly after conversion. It's expected, not a bug — don't file tickets for it. The full rounding policy and worked examples live on our team wiki page.

runbook for taduf-kawef: https://confluence.qorvelsys.internal/projects/display/display/pages